I’ve released quite a few tools using Google Sheets, but a frustrating aspect of using Google Sheets to release these tools rather than a software is keeping the user updated. Usually, I have to resort to email blasts or new videos/blog posts to try and get just a fraction of the tool’s users to migrate to the latest version. After some digging, I discovered three methods for cross-document version control with Google Sheets by leveraging popups, scripts, and helper sheets to notify users of new versions.
